a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Jeff Law <law@redhat.com>1994-11-16 17:06:20 +0000
committerJeff Law <law@redhat.com>1994-11-16 17:06:20 +0000
commit831d7ac47c3cbcfb7dd635a18b3dfeaa58a0706d (patch)
tree247b6eeddc0ed68a3c9e767d117be4eef5947e29
parentf32fc5f9790cdab127622f3a3f3bdc2474fe9da5 (diff)
downloadgdb-831d7ac47c3cbcfb7dd635a18b3dfeaa58a0706d.zip
gdb-831d7ac47c3cbcfb7dd635a18b3dfeaa58a0706d.tar.gz
gdb-831d7ac47c3cbcfb7dd635a18b3dfeaa58a0706d.tar.bz2
* scripttempl/hppaelf.sc (.text): Place unwind descriptors in the
text segment.
-rw-r--r--ld/ChangeLog12
-rw-r--r--ld/scripttempl/hppaelf.sc6
2 files changed, 15 insertions, 3 deletions
diff --git a/ld/ChangeLog b/ld/ChangeLog
index 31b9ff0..e15b2f3 100644
--- a/ld/ChangeLog
+++ b/ld/ChangeLog
@@ -1,5 +1,17 @@
+Wed Nov 16 10:03:03 1994 Jeff Law (law@snake.cs.utah.edu)
+
+ * scripttempl/hppaelf.sc (.text): Place unwind descriptors in the
+ text segment.
+
Sat Nov 12 15:55:56 1994 Ian Lance Taylor (ian@tweedledumb.cygnus.com)
+ Patches from Eric Youngdale <eric@aib.com>:
+ * ldlang.c (lang_finish): Don't warn if entry symbol not found
+ when generating a shared library.
+ * emultempl/elf32.em (gld${EMULATION_NAME}_place_orphan): Warn if
+ attempting to place an orphaned relocation section when generating
+ a dynamically linked object.
+
* scripttempl/elf.sc: Add ENTRY(${ENTRY}), and default ${ENTRY} to
_start.
diff --git a/ld/scripttempl/hppaelf.sc b/ld/scripttempl/hppaelf.sc
index 21b6085..53a55e5 100644
--- a/ld/scripttempl/hppaelf.sc
+++ b/ld/scripttempl/hppaelf.sc
@@ -3,7 +3,6 @@ OUTPUT_FORMAT("${OUTPUT_FORMAT}")
OUTPUT_ARCH(${ARCH})
ENTRY("\$START\$")
${RELOCATING+${LIB_SEARCH_DIRS}}
-${RELOCATING+___stack_zero = ABSOLUTE(0x2000);}
SECTIONS
{
.text ${RELOCATING+${TEXT_START_ADDR}}:
@@ -12,10 +11,11 @@ SECTIONS
CREATE_OBJECT_SYMBOLS
*(.PARISC.stubs)
*(.text)
+ *(.PARISC.unwind)
${RELOCATING+etext = .};
${RELOCATING+_etext = .};
}
- .data ${RELOCATING+ 0x40000000 } :
+ .data 0x40000000 :
{
${RELOCATING+ . = . + 0x1000 };
${RELOCATING+__data_start = .};
@@ -24,7 +24,7 @@ SECTIONS
${RELOCATING+edata = .};
${RELOCATING+_edata = .};
}
- .bss ${RELOCATING+SIZEOF(.data) + ADDR(.data)} :
+ .bss 0x40000000 ${RELOCATING++SIZEOF(.data)} :
{
*(.bss)
*(COMMON)